Main issues, as the Inspector framed them
- the effect of the proposed development on the character and appearance of the area, including the green infrastructure corridor
- the integrity of the Special Protection Area (SPA)
What decided it
The proposed steel containers would constitute incongruous industrial structures that would harm the character and appearance of the rural area and the green infrastructure corridor, conflicting with the development plan with no material considerations of sufficient weight to justify approval.
